CSS And Tables: The Hype And The Trends

The of information

Before furniture came along, the internet was a quite dull place. Using dining tables for structure opened up fresh vistas of possibilities of visually? designing? a webpage. It could very well be contended that desk based structure was in charge of the popularity of the web plus the field of web design.

Worse continue to, over the last few years, table founded layout comes under serious criticism and was widely demonized. Internet purists declare that tables were never suitable for layout consequently one ought not to use them for the purpose of such. A rapidly sophisicated hype seems to be in the air round.

Reality behind the hype

Despite the fact that pioneers have been referring to web criteria for a long time, virtually all web sites remain developed using tables and non standards compliant code. History has shown many instances of technologies that started out existence with you purpose, only to end up finding more functional applications because something else. And it sounds extremely apt in the instance of tables. The internet itself was never can be a funnel for edutainment, marketing and info but for sharing research info.

Using tables is mostly a pragmatic methodology, if not really preferred

The W3c Web Accessibility Guidelines know that designers might continue to use table for layout – so include info on how they can become implemented in the most accessible way. Designers are not going to quickly stop employing tables for layout; generally owning towards the reason that the is the default behavior on most WYSWYG (what you see is actually you get) Web design packages and; CSS for layout is so difficult to implement successfully.

In addition, Professionals continue to argue the usage of tables with respect to the layout of pages on the net, despite the fact that this goes against current specifications. They claim it to be a pragmatic strategy? if not their recommended options.

Let’s increase the misguided beliefs: CSS vs Tables

Many web designers don’t just feel the need to switch over

The majority of websites are still designed using trestle tables and no standards up to date code. Due to this, user solutions will be forced to handle desk based designs for many years to come. This kind of effectively does away with one of the biggest retailing points with regards to web expectations. That of onward compatibility. Essential, most site designers really don’t look there is a tough need to start off developing sites using CSS based layouts and benchmarks compliant code.

CSS development possesses a much higher obstacle to entry than table based design

When comparing desk based design and style to CSS based design, the syntax of CSS, for sure, turns out to be is quite easy. Nobody in their right mind would probably argue that you need too be described as a rocket science tecnistions to learn CSS. Nevertheless, a number of the concepts can be very tricky to assimilate.

Continuing inside the same character it is the case that there are a lot of bugs, even the? experts? end up spending an inordinate length of time bug mending. For a beginner this has to be extremely irritating. Not knowing in the event the problem is to your misconception of CSS or some imprecise browser pest.

Most likely this why various people check out web requirements as? Ivory Tower? and why many web specifications advocates appear having a good sense of brilliance and a zealous frame of mind towards web page design.

Some things are just easy-to-do with furniture

People often find themselves writing fairly complicated CSS to do something which would be trivial using tables. Take contact form styling meant for an instance. One could lay out even very complicated forms using tables in just a few minutes. You are able to achieve similar results by floating elements with CSS, although it’s a much more involved. For anybody who is a CSS guru it could all part of the fun. However when you’re a regular mortal, it can be incredibly frustrating.

Another this kind of thing is definitely page footers. It’s really easy to do applying tables. Even though doing this employing CSS by themselves, it would barely be virtually any wonder as to why web developers simply turn their again on CSS when possibly simple things are rendered and so

If you have the knowledge and patience, that you can do most things applying CSS that you just used to do employing tables. Sure it may take you longer, yet you’ll get right now there in the end (or die trying).

CSS benefits. But should it provide you what exactly you need?

It’s true that switching a big site into a CSS established layout conserve a huge amount of band width. However , for almost all sites, this saving will be insignificant or perhaps mostly irrevelent.

People want quickly loading internet pages and many recommends have advised that CSS helps make this happen. For most sites, the? design and style? is unfold evenly throughout the whole site. However with CSS based sites, the? design and style? is usually held in one or more external files. These files could be fairly complicated, and even for a simple internet site, can get big, or even fast.

Internet search engine friendliness: CSS vs Kitchen tables

It’s accurate that the search engines like yahoo like semantic pages. Recharging options a widely held notion that search engines like google like lean code. Creating a site applying CSS and web criteria can defiantly encourage the development of search engine friendly sites. On the other hand it’s neither magic bullet, nor a remedio either.

There are many table based sites that score very extremely in the search engines. They have equally practical to build a CSS centered site that gets a terrible search engine ranking. The most important thing to get high rank is content material and inbound links, not whether a site uses tables or perhaps CSS for layout.

Issues concerning accessibility

There is quite increasing number of people who try to sell web specifications and especially CSS based design and style by playing on customer’s accessibility fearfulness.

There isn’t anything inherently inaccessible about table based upon design. Although it’s authentic that your web blog needs to be publicized to a recognized set of grammars to receive an SOCIAL MEDIA PACKAGE accessibility ranking, tableless design is only a recommendation, accomplish requirement for a lot more stringent AAA rating.

The final expression

Final Table centered design will be around for a long period. However , not necessarily good enough simply to say that it is wrong to use them. In many circumstances using tables meant for layout can make much more perception than CSS.

World wide web standards and CSS structured design happen to be defiantly just how forward. Yet, in the rush to advocate these types of? new? methods, people turn out to be hyperbolic estherdereu.com plus the reality declines short of goals.

A sensible approach to obtain what you carry on and seek is definitely the need with the hour no matter what is in style, or offered out of proportions.

Leave a Reply

Your email address will not be published. Required fields are marked *